While Sandhurst (Berks) station may not boast the extensive amenities found in larger stations, it provides the essentials for a smooth journey. There is no ticket office or ticket machine, so it's best to purchase your tickets online ahead of time. While the station lacks step-free access across the entire site, there is partial access via steep ramps. Visitors needing assistance can connect with staff through the help points and enjoy the convenience of passenger information screens and announcements.
Although amenities such as waiting rooms, refreshments, shops, and toilets are absent, there is seating for travelers to rest before their journey. An induction loop is available to assist passengers with hearing devices. While Wi-Fi and phone services aren't available, you can still enjoy the natural beauty and tranquility of the area as you wait for your train.
Sandhurst (Berks) station provides several key travel connections for your onward journey. If your plans are interrupted, rail replacement services are accessible at bus stops on Yorktown Road. Taxis aren't available directly at the station, but local services can be arranged in advance. For those planning further ventures, Sandhurst links with major air travel routes via Reading for Heathrow and Gatwick, with a service change at Bristol Temple Meads for Bristol Airport.
A bicycle storage area accommodates those preferring two wheels, while the availability of cycle hire services offers another convenient option to explore further afield. Commuters seeking to explore by bus can access information online to effectively plan their journeys.

Streatham Common station is equipped with essential amenities to cater to travelers' needs. For those purchasing or collecting train tickets, the station has you covered. Ticket offices are open from early morning until late evening—on weekdays from 06:15 to 20:00, Saturdays stretching till 21:00, and Sundays wrapping up at 17:45. Convenient ticket machines accepting Disabled Persons Railcard discounts ensure an inclusive travel experience. Collecting tickets bought online is a breeze here.
Accessibility plays a crucial role in the station's layout. It boasts step-free access throughout, making it user-friendly for wheelchair users and those with mobility issues. This accessibility extends to platform 1 and 2 via lifts. While tactile pavements may not edge all platforms, staff assistance is readily available, ensuring a comfortable journey from start to finish. Rest assured, safety is paramount, with CCTV keeping a vigilant eye, although travelers should note that accessible toilets are not available.
Streatham Common offers a variety of transport links to continue your journey beyond the station. Taxis are accessible just a short distance away on Estreham Road, making it easy to reach your next destination. Local bus services also provide substantial connectivity to the wider area, ensuring passengers can seamlessly transition from train to bus when needed.
